Summit Carbon Solutions tells Hall County it will restart landowner outreach for new pipeline route
Summary
A project manager for Summit Carbon Solutions told commissioners the company has new management and a different proposed route through southeastern Hall County and said company representatives will begin contacting landowners and return with a fuller presentation in coming weeks.

At the start of the meeting a Summit Carbon Solutions project manager introduced herself and said the firm is restarting outreach for a carbon-capture pipeline under new management and with a different route proposal that would run through southeastern Hall County.
Kylie Lang, the company's Nebraska project manager, said the company will reach out to landowners over the coming weeks, does not have an up-to-date map to present now because routes are still being developed in response to landowner feedback, and will return to the board for a full presentation. "We're going to start reaching out just to see if landowners are interested in the project," she said, adding that the company will leave contact information with county staff.
Commissioners advised the company to request time on a future agenda so the presentation can be scheduled formally and so the board has time to hear a full proposal and maps. The exchange was a public comment/notice of intent rather than a permit or formal application; commissioners said they expected a fuller presentation in one to two months.
